Understanding Church Website Builders

‍

A church website builder is a specialized tool or platform that allows churches to create and manage their websites without the need for extensive coding or web development knowledge. It differs from traditional web development methods by providing user-friendly interfaces and pre-designed templates tailored to the specific needs of churches.

‍

There are several advantages to using website builders for churches:

‍

1. Cost-effectiveness: Church website builders offer affordable solutions compared to hiring professional web developers or agencies. They often provide various pricing plans, allowing churches of different sizes and budgets to find an option that suits them.

‍

2. Ease of use: Website builders are designed with simplicity in mind, making it accessible for churches without technical expertise. The intuitive drag-and-drop interfaces and pre-designed templates make it easy to create and customize a website without writing code.

‍

3. Time-saving: Church website builders provide pre-built templates and features specifically designed for churches, reducing the time and effort required to set up a website. With ready-to-use elements like event calendars, sermon libraries, and donation integration, churches can quickly create a comprehensive online platform.

‍

4. Flexibility and customization: While website builders offer pre-designed templates, they also allow for customization to match the unique branding and identity of each church. Churches can personalize colors, fonts, images, and content to create a website that reflects their values and vision.

‍

5. Updates and maintenance: Website builders often handle the technical aspects of website maintenance, including software updates, security, and hosting. This allows churches to focus on their ministry without worrying about the technical details.

‍

By utilizing a church website builder, churches can save time, money, and effort while still creating a professional and engaging online presence. In the next section, we will delve deeper into the features and considerations when choosing a church website builder.

Exploring the Top Church Website Builders

‍

When it comes to choosing a church website builder, there are several reputable options available in the market. Here are some of the top church website builders to consider:

‍

1. The Church Co. - The Church Co. provides customizable website templates designed specifically for churches. It offers features like sermon management, event calendars, online giving, and member directories. The Church Co. focuses on simplicity and ease of use for churches of all sizes.

Website: https://thechurchco.com/

‍

2. Sharefaith: Sharefaith is a popular choice among churches due to its extensive library of customizable templates and media resources. It offers features like sermon uploading, event management, online donations, and even a church app builder. Sharefaith caters to churches looking for a combination of user-friendly design tools and ministry-focused features.

Website: https://www.sharefaith.com/church-websites/

‍

3. Clover Sites: Clover Sites is known for its visually appealing templates and intuitive website editor. It offers features like sermon podcasting, event calendars, and online forms. Clover Sites is a great option for churches seeking a modern and professional website design.

Website: https://www.cloversites.com/

‍

4. Subsplash - Subsplash offers a range of church technology solutions, including website builders. It provides features like sermon management, event calendars, online giving, and media integration. Subsplash's integrated platform allows churches to create unified and engaging online experiences. Website: https://www.subsplash.com/websites

‍

5. Nucleus - Nucleus is a church website builder that emphasizes community engagement. It offers features like sermon management, event calendars, online giving, and group management. Nucleus focuses on creating interactive websites to foster connection and growth within churches.

Website: https://www.nucleus.church/

‍

When considering which church website builder to choose, it's essential to assess the specific needs of your church. Consider factors such as the size of your congregation, the desired features and functionalities, and the level of customization required.

Features to Consider

‍

When evaluating church website builders, there are several key features to consider:

‍

1. Sermon Integration: Look for a builder that allows seamless integration of audio or video sermons, making it easy for visitors to access and engage with the church's teachings.

‍

2. Event Management: Ensure the website builder provides tools for creating and managing events, including registration, ticketing, and reminders.

‍

3. Online Giving: A crucial feature for churches, online giving options allow visitors to make donations securely and conveniently.

‍

4. Mobile Responsiveness: In today's mobile-driven world, it's essential for your church website to be mobile-friendly and responsive across different devices.

‍

5. SEO Optimization: Look for builders that provide built-in SEO tools or integrations to improve your website's visibility in search engine results.

‍

6. Customization Options: Consider the level of customization available in terms of design, layout, color schemes, and fonts to ensure your website reflects your church's branding.

‍

Pros and Cons of Church Website Builders

‍

1. Advantages of Church Website Builders:

   a. Ease of use: Church website builders offer user-friendly interfaces that require no coding knowledge, making it accessible to church staff or volunteers with limited technical expertise.

‍

   b. Pre-designed templates: Builders provide a wide selection of professionally designed templates tailored for churches, allowing for quick and visually appealing website setup.

‍

   c. Quick setup: With ready-to-use features and content modules, church website builders streamline the website creation process, saving time and effort.

‍

2. Potential Drawbacks of Church Website Builders:

   a. Limitations in customization: While builders offer customization options, they may have limitations in terms of design flexibility and advanced functionality, restricting the extent of unique branding or complex website requirements.

‍

   b. Scalability challenges: Some builders may have limitations in scaling the website as the church grows, potentially requiring a transition to a more robust platform in the future.

‍

Factors to Consider in Choosing the Right Builder

‍

1. Budget: Evaluate the pricing plans and ongoing costs associated with each church website builder, considering the available features and scalability to ensure it aligns with the church's financial resources.

‍

2. Technical expertise: Assess the skill level and familiarity of the church staff or volunteers who will manage and update the website. Choose a builder that matches their comfort level and provides adequate support and training resources.

‍

3. Specific church requirements: Consider the unique needs of the church, such as sermon integration, event management, online giving options, multilingual support, or integration with other church management systems. Ensure the chosen builder offers the necessary features to meet these requirements.

‍

4. Design and customization: Evaluate the design options, template selection, and customization capabilities of each builder to ensure the website reflects the church's brand and vision effectively.

‍

5. Support and resources: Research the level of customer support provided by the builder, including access to technical assistance, documentation, tutorials, and user communities. A responsive support system can be valuable in overcoming any challenges during website development and management.
